BRAKE > General Description
SPECIFICATION
NOTE:
Refer to “PARKING BRAKE” for parking brake specifications. General Description > SPECIFICATION">
1. FRONT DISC BRAKE
Item | Specification | ||
Size | 16-inch type | ||
Type | Floating 2-POT piston type Ventilated disc | ||
Effective cylinder diameter | mm (in) | 42.8 (1.685) ? 2 | |
Pad dimension (Length ? Width ? Thickness) | mm (in) | 117.8 ? 50.5 ? 11.0 (4.638 ? 1.988 ? 0.433) | |
Pad thickness | mm (in) | Standard | 11 (0.43) |
Limit | 1.5 (0.059) | ||
Effective disc diameter | mm (in) | 244 (9.61) | |
Rotor dimension (O.D. ? Thickness) | mm (in) | 294 ? 24 (11.57 ? 0.94) | |
Disc thickness | mm (in) | Standard | 24 (0.94) |
Limit | 22 (0.87) | ||
Disc runout | mm (in) | Standard | — |
Limit | 0.05 (0.002) | ||
Clearance adjustment | Automatic adjustment | ||
2. REAR DISC BRAKE
Item | Specification | ||
Size | 15-inch | ||
Type | Floating 1-POT piston type | ||
Effective cylinder diameter | mm (in) | 38.1 (1.500) | |
Pad dimension (Length ? Width ? Thickness) | mm (in) | 92.0 ? 33.0 ? 9.0 (3.622 ? 1.299 ? 0.354) | |
Pad thickness | mm (in) | Standard | 9.0 (0.354) |
Limit | 1.5 (0.059) | ||
Effective disc diameter | mm (in) | 238 (9.37) | |
Rotor dimension (O.D. ? Thickness) | mm (in) | 274 ? 10 (10.79 ? 0.39) | |
Disc thickness | mm (in) | Standard | 10 (0.39) |
Limit | 8.5 (0.335) | ||
Disc runout | mm (in) | Standard | — |
Limit | 0.05 (0.002) | ||
Clearance adjustment | Automatic adjustment | ||
3. MASTER CYLINDER
Item | Specification | |
Type | Tandem | |
Effective diameter | mm (in) | 23.8 (15/16) |
Reservoir type | Sealed type | |
Brake fluid reservoir capacity | cm3 (cu in) | 240 (14.64) |
4. BRAKE BOOSTER
Item | Specification | ||
Type | Vacuum suspended | ||
Effective diameter | mm (in) | 208 + 229 (8.19 + 9.02) | |
Brake fluid pressure | Brake pedal force N (kgf, lbf) | Fluid pressure kPa (kgf/cm2, psi) | |
When engine is stopped | 147 (15, 33) | 533 (5, 77) | |
294 (30, 66) | 1,551 (16, 225) | ||
While engine operates and when the vacuum pressure is as follows: 66.7 kPa (500 mmHg, 19.69 inHg) | 147 (15, 33) | 6,177 (63, 896) | |
294 (30, 66) | 11,273 (115, 1,635) | ||
5. BRAKE LINE, BRAKE PEDAL AND BRAKE FLUID
CAUTION:
• Do not let brake fluid come into contact with the painted surface of the vehicle body. Wash away with water immediately and wipe off if it is spilled by accident.
• Avoid mixing brake fluid of different brands or different grades even from the same brand to prevent fluid performance from degrading.
• When refilling brake fluid, do not allow dirt or dust to get into the reservoir tank.
• Always use new SUBARU genuine brake fluid when replacing or refilling the fluid. Do not reuse drained brake fluid.
Item | Specification | ||
Brake line | Dual circuit system | ||
Brake pedal | Type | Suspended type | |
Free play | mm (in) | 0.5 — 2.7 (0.020 — 0.11) [When pulling the brake pedal upward with a force of less than 10 N (1 kgf, 2 lbf)] | |
Brake fluid | FMVSS No. 116, DOT3, or DOT4 | ||
